I USE 2 Tablespoons of GENERAL FOODS INTERNATIONAL VANILLA CARAMEL LATTE from the makers of Maxwell House INSTEAD of Folgers Caramel Groove Cafe Latte Mix, but this site does not recognize it because it is new.
2
Fill your blender almost to the top.
3
Add skim milk to blender.
4
Mix 2 TBSP Vanilla Caramel Latte with your coffee until dissolved than add to blender.
5
Blend on Med To High Speed. My blender has a Frappe speed and that is what I use. Blend until you reach the consistency you prefer. You can always add more milk if this mixture is to thick. If you do not use enough Ice, it will be very watery and it will not be anything like McDonalds Frappe.
6
Top with Whipped Cream and Caramel. I also stir in some Caramel before adding the Whipped Cream. But to each his own.
